So, when UK bakery chain Greggs included a giant sausage roll in a nativity scene advert right where the baby Jesus was supposed to be, understandably, people were a little bit confused.
Some people were even angry.
But most, to be honest, just thought it was the funniest thing that ever happened in the history of advertising.
Here's the image in question.

And here's one person who thought that equating the Jewish son of God to a sausage roll was wildly inappropriate.
However, others weren't so bothered by the photo. They actually found it quite funny. And seeing as it is literally a photo of a sausage roll lying in a manger, we can very much see why. https://twitter.com/Novembervivi/status/930736256283234304 https://twitter.com/tomvictor/status/930733592984084480 https://twitter.com/Prague_Tony/status/930757989664985088 https://twitter.com/DawnHFoster/status/930724002913570816 The image was created to promote Greggs' advent calendar which hopefully includes a little steak pie behind every door. However, due to the amount of attention the sausage roll nativity scene has been getting (and the few complaints that have come with it), the bakery chain has been forced to apologise for replacing the baby Jesus with some pork wrapped in pastry.
